Time TimeFormat
Set the time format.
Requires user role: USER
Value space: <24H/12H>
24H: Set the time format to 24 hours.
12H: Set the time format to 12 hours (AM/PM).
Example: xConguration Time TimeFormat: 24H
Time DateFormat
Set the date format.
Requires user role: USER
Value space: <DD _ MM _ YY/MM _ DD _ YY/YY _ MM _ DD>
DD_MM_YY: The date January 30th 2010 will be displayed: 30.01.10
MM_DD_YY: The date January 30th 2010 will be displayed: 01.30.10
YY_MM_DD: The date January 30th 2010 will be displayed: 10.01.30
Example: xConguration Time DateFormat: DD _ MM _ YY
